First came the emancipation, then came energy and power, and now come Memoirs of an Imperfect Angel, the new album by interna­tional superstar Mariah Carey, scheduled to arrive on September 29th. The first new single pick from Memoirs is "Obsessed,". The video for "Obsessed" is directed by Brett Ratner. "Obsessed" was written and produced by Mariah, The-Dream and Tricky Stewart, who are responsible for the majority of tracks on the new album. Memoirs was executive-produced by Antonio "L.A." Reid. Memoirs of an Imperfect Angel, the 12th studio album of Mariah's career, is the eagerly anticipated follow-up to her RIAA platinum-selling album E=MC² (released April 15, 2008), and her worldwide 10 million selling The Emancipation Of Mimi (released April 12, 2005). Both were Soundscan #1 debut albums that made chart history for Mariah in the U.S. and numerous territories around the globe.

The Emancipation Of Mimi generated three Grammy awards (including Best Contemp­orary R&B Album), two #1 singles, and countless more honors during its 18-month chart stay. The album debuted at #1 on first week sales of 404,000 copies, Mariah's highest first week sales total (until E=MC²;). Soundscan's biggest-selling album of 2005, Mimi featured "We Belong Together" (Grammy winner for Best Female R&B Vocal and Best R&B Song) and "Don't Forget About Us," Mariah's 16th and 17th #1 career singles respectively. They tied one of the most enduring chart records in Billboard Hot 100 history, Elvis Presley's 17 #1's.

Three years later, E=MC²; debuted at #1 on first week sales of 463,000 copies, which now stands as the highest first week sales total of Mariah's career. The album's success brought total sales of Mariah's albums, singles and videos to more than 160 million worldwide, distancing her even further from the pack as the top-selling female recording artist in history.

E=MC² spun off four singles: "Touch My Body," "Bye Bye," "I'll Be Lovin' U Long Time," and "I Stay In Love." Of these, "Touch My Body" made history when it became Mariah's 18th #1 Hot 100 hit, thus surpassing Elvis Presley. "Touch My Body"'s two weeks at the top also marked Mariah's 78th and 79th cumulative career weeks at #1, which tied Elvis' long-standing all-time high of 79 weeks at #1, as calculated in Billboard.com. At the same time, Mariah is now positioned as the only active recording artist in the 50 years of the Hot 100 (which began in 1958) with the potential to surpass the Beatles' all-time high of 20 #1 hits.

Imperfect Timing, Almost Perfect Album 4 Star Review
2009-12-24 - Indeed, Mariah's 2009 offering had one thing wrong - the timing. Coming less than 18 months after E=MC2, which was considered rather similar to the 2005's acclaimed comeback "The Emancipation of Mimi", even myself was not decided to give it a try. Apparently, I was not alone. Even with postponed release dates, "Memoirs" had a lesser commercial success than any of its two predecessors - and produced no No.1 single - something that the singer sometimes had too much emphasized in her career.

This all aside, I was more than happy when I got a chance to listen to the album - Mariah cast all pretense aside (the cover may be misleading, as there is no visible sign of breaking from the sexy uniformity of previous covers) and made a classic r&b album, helmed by just one major producer duo, The Dream and Tricky Stewart. After a few listens it is really clear: Those who assert that this is the best Mariah since "Butterfly" (1997) are right!

The singer-songwriter's knack for melodies is intact, as witnessed in the tracks like "H.A.T.E.U." or "Ribbon". The Dream and Tricky's contribution is clearly audible as well, particularly on tracks like "Standing O", which reminds of them-wheeled Rihanna's super smash "Umbrella". Less robotic than that 2007 hit, however, Carey's album overflows with warmth, soulful grooves and is free of melismatic singing that used to put off many casual listeners.

The lead single "Obsessed" is as catchy as the 2008 No.1 hit "Touch My Body". Similar melodic and lyric motives show up every now and then, giving the album a satisfying sense of fulfilment. Finishing with "I Want to Know What Love Is" (where the gospel choir is sounding strangely tame, as if going half-steam), the album is a testimony to Mariah's often-underrated artistry and although it is probably not good enough to win new fans, it's a cohesive bag which probably shows the singer in her real state, giving fans a chance to live things with her. Seems like marital bliss works well for Mariah...
